High Resolution Forest Remote SensingTU Wien is Austria’s largest institution of research and higher education in the fields of technology and natural sciences. With over 26,000 students and more than 4000 scientists, research, teaching, and learning dedicated to the advancement of science and technology have been conducted here for more than 200 years, guided by the motto “Technology for People”. As a driver of innovation, TU Wien fosters close collaboration with business and industry and contributes to the prosperity of society.At the Department of Geodesy and Geoinformation, in the Research Unit of Photogrammetry, TU Wien is offering the following tenure track position for 40 hours/week. Expected start: November 2024.The position is initially limited to a period of expected six years and, if a qualification agreement is concluded and fulfilled, includes the possibility of being taken on as an Associate Professor for an indefinite period.The tenure-track position is affiliated to the Department of Geodesy and Geoinformation. Duties include research and teaching in the field of Photogrammetry. The focus of research should be on multi-platform multi-sensor high resolution Earth observation for 3D modeling of vegetation including the application and extension of those models for applied monitoring of forest resources.Tasks: Research:

  • Research in the field of high-resolution Earth observation, especially of forest resources, and in the field of 3D acquisition and modeling of vegetation
  • Promotion of interdisciplinary research in the fields of geodesy, geoinformation and environmental engineering
  • Acquisition of research projects (national and European/international)

Teaching:

  • The successful candidate will teach independently in the Bachelor and Master curricula Geodesy and Geoinformation as well as Environmental Engineering
  • Teaching will be in the form of classes, lab courses, and excursions as well as supervising academic theses
  • Development of innovative teaching approaches and contribution to the outreach activities of the Department of Geodesy and Geoinformation
  • It is emphasized that currently the teaching in the Bachelor curriculum is in German language requiring appropriate language skills
